Having to deal with insects and ants within one’s home habitat is certainly not something nice to deal with. Especially in spring and summer, however, it is not uncommon to come across certain insects that can infest certain areas of the house.
In this article we want to talk specifically about ants. These insects can proliferate in a big way, attracted by the presence of food, crumbs or some particular smells. The problem, then, will not be able to arise only and exclusively for people living in the countryside or in a detached house.
In fact, ants are also used to climb walls and will be able to infest even houses located in apartment buildings on higher floors. Many people experience this problem with much anxiety and seek any strategy to “block” their entry into the bathroom or other intimate rooms of the house.
